Joyce Crane Community,
It is with heavy hearts that we announce the loss of a respected and longtime employee of Joyce Crane, Ricky Potts.
I had the pleasure of working with Ricky since Joyce Crane first began in 1985 and witnessed his faithful service to our company for over 30 years.
Beginning as a field superintendent, he traveled the country on jobs from California to Texas. After moving to management, he held a number of critical positions over the years, including financial administrator, payroll, time keeping, billing, permits, and registration of equipment, among others, and was instrumental to the success of Joyce Crane.
Ricky was born and raised in Monahans, Texas, and proudly served his country in the United States Army. He was an avid fisherman, was sponsored by Skeeter Boats, and competed in a variety of fishing tournaments, an aspect of his life that always impressed me.
Ricky was one of a kind and truly part of the Joyce Crane family. It was an honor to know and work beside him for so many years. He will be greatly missed.
Services honoring the life of Ricky Potts will be this weekend at Radar Funeral Home at1617 Judson Road in Longview. Services will begin with the viewing on Sunday, March 4, from 5:00 p.m. until 7:00 p.m.
A Chapel Service will take place the following day, Monday, March 5, at 10:00 a.m. with the graveside service immediately to follow at 11:00 a.m. at Rosewood Park, 1884 FM 1844.
All of our thoughts and prayers are with Ricky’s family as they grieve the loss of truly remarkable man.

Obituary for Linda June Hargrave
Linda June Hargrave passed away July 21, 2016. She was born December 13, 1947 in Monahans. Linda was a loving Mother and Granny and will be missed by all who knew and loved her. She was preceded in death by her parents, Slim and Carlynn Perucca and husband John Calvin Hargrave.
Linda is survived by her children, Anna Shanee Hudson and husband Chaise, Steven Brent Hargrave, John David Hargrave and wife Edwina; grandchildren, Brianna Green, Tyler Green, Ashtin Hudson, Byrce Hargrave, Chase Hargrave, Aden Hargrave, Brittany Hargrave, and Derrick Hargrave; great-grandson, Easton Hargrave; sisters, Kay Holmes and Robbie McKee; brothers, Barney Perucca and Lynn Perucca; and numerous nieces, nephews and friends.
Funeral services will be held 10 a.m. Tuesday, July 26 at Galbreaith-Pickard Funeral Chapel with burial following at Annetta Cemetery. Visitation will be held Monday evening from 6-8 p.m. at the funeral home. In lieu of flowers donations may be made to Community Hospice of Texas or to the American Cancer Society.
